L7 bassist Jennifer Finch has been diagnosed with an aggressive form of brain cancer and is receiving extensive medical care following multiple surgeries and serious complications. The diagnosis means she cannot join the band’s forthcoming US dates on its Last Hurrah Tour, although L7 says it will continue at her request, making the news significant for both the group and its fans.

Finch, 59, has performed with L7 and other groups during a music career spanning several decades. L7 has launched a GoFundMe campaign to fund her rehabilitation and professional in-home support; it had raised more than $299,000 towards a $350,000 target, with some donations reaching $10,000.
